Top Qs
Timeline
Chat
Perspective

Djemaa Ouled cheikh

Place in Aïn Defla, Algeria From Wikipedia, the free encyclopedia

Djemaa Ouled cheikhmap
Remove ads

Djemaa Ouled is a town in northern Algeria.

Quick Facts Country, Province ...

36.07793°N 2.00500°E / 36.07793; 2.00500


Remove ads
Loading related searches...

Wikiwand - on

Seamless Wikipedia browsing. On steroids.

Remove ads